Challenges

  • The project scope is not written clearly in the contract, so extra requests get done for free.
  • Milestones and deliverables are not tracked, so projects drag on for months.
  • With no revision limit, the same page gets changed again and again for free.
  • Hosting and maintenance renewals are remembered by hand, so service continues without invoicing.

Workflows

From contract to delivery

  1. The project contract is opened with scope, milestones and a revision limit.
  2. Each milestone is closed with a delivery record and client approval.
  3. An approved stage triggers the installment in the collection plan.

From launch to subscription

  1. When the site goes live, the hosting and maintenance subscription starts.
  2. The subscription invoice is issued automatically at the start of each period.
  3. A revision request beyond the limit becomes an extra work order and quote.

FAQ

Can I collect payment per milestone?

Yes — the collection plan is tied to stages; an approved delivery triggers the related installment.

Can I track the revision limit?

Yes — every revision request is counted; once the limit is exceeded, an extra quote is generated.

Can I invoice hosting and maintenance automatically?

Yes — the subscription record issues the recurring invoice by itself at the start of each period.

Can I see project slippage?

Yes — milestone dates are compared with the plan; a delayed stage shows in the report.

Can I work out profit per client?

Yes — spent effort and external costs post to the project, so client profitability is visible.
